1403476
0xddfdd7df76425af3b4e233e832dc094c1d70c91f0f019d266ff21fdbb0eeaf1a
Transactions0
Height1403476
Confirmations4359940
Timestamp351 days 1 hour ago
Size (bytes)1009
Version
Merkle Root
Nonce0x446d69dcbe988a6c
Bits
Difficulty0x159bd